Pryme Group makes three key appointments to senior leadership team

02/11/2022

Pryme Group, an innovative engineering collective that designs, creates and delivers solutions to diverse global industrial markets, has made three senior appointments across the group, strengthening its energy transition credentials and growth strategy.

L-R Barbara McIntyre – Operations & Engineering Director at Caley Ocean Systems, David Hodkinson – Chief Commercial Officer at Pryme Group and Simon Wain – Managing Director at Caley Ocean Systems. The trio of new recruits are pictured together at Caley Ocean Systems HQ in Govan, Glasgow

David Hodkinson joins Aberdeenshire-headquartered Pryme Group as Chief Commercial Officer. David will work with the executive team and company leadership to drive the development and delivery of a group-wide commercial strategy, targeting growth in sustainable high value sectors. 

David has previously worked within the global renewables and clean energies sector, as well as holding commercial and programme advisory roles in the UK Ministry of Defence’s headquarters. In addition, he has worked in defence equipment and consultancy organisations. He has proven experience driving revenue growth through innovative industry partnerships and new service propositions.

Two further appointments have been made within Pryme Group company, Caley Ocean Systems. Simon Wain has been promoted to Managing Director, to build on the success of recent years and continue growing the business. Simon joined Caley in 2020 as Project Director, during which time he managed one of Caley’s largest projects in the offshore wind sector, delivering innovative PileProp © systems for Ailes Marines for the Saint-Brieuc Offshore Wind Farm off the coast of Brittany, France.

Chartered engineer and Fellow of the Institution of Mechanical Engineers, Barbara McIntyre, has joined Caley Ocean Systems as Operations and Engineering Director. Barbara comes to Caley with 20 years of leadership and design engineering experience across a range of sectors including transport, defence and energy.
